10. George Morikawa
Net Worth: $3 Million

Hajime no Ippo, a boxing-themed sports manga by George Morikawa, is his most well-known work. The manga first made its appearance in the late 1980s and was one of the most influential works by a manga artist at the time.
The story of Hajime no Ippo has been told in over 132 tankbon volumes and is still running. In addition, an anime television series with 76 episodes premiered in 2000, which was eventually translated into two more seasons due to overwhelming public demand.
As of 2020, Hajime no Ippo had sold over 100 million manga copies, which is reflected in Morikawa’s net worth. Morikawa, who has a personal net worth of roughly $3-4 million, has even won the 15th Kodansha Manga Award in the shnen category for his work on Hajime no Ippo.
9. Keisuke Itagaki
Net Worth: $5 Million

Baki The Grappler, a martial arts manga, is well-known for its beautiful moments and brutal fight scenes. It is one of the first Netflix original anime shows and has been renewed through a number of different plot arcs. Keisuke Itagaki is the creator of this comic.
Itagaki’s net worth is reported to be between $5 and $6 million, with manga sales from Baki The Grappler accounting for a sizable portion of his earnings. Baki has sold almost 85 million manga copies as of 2022, including all sequel sales.
The addition of Netflix improved the series’ popularity while also increasing manga sales. Aside from manga and anime adaptations, other video game adaptations are also accessible on the market, adding to Itagaki’s net worth.
8. Yoichi Takahashi
Net Worth: $6 Million

Captain Tsubasa’s manga author is Yoichi Takahashi. Captain Tsubasa was an extremely successful football-themed sports manga in the early 1980s, and it is well recognised for its significant contribution to Japanese football history.
Captain Tsubasa is one of the best-selling manga series, with over 80 million copies sold worldwide. Takahashi is also recognised for his other soccer manga series ‘Hungry Heart: Wild Striker’, in addition to Captain Tsubasa.
He was welcomed as a guest to the football team FC Barcelona in 2016, and he has garnered numerous honours for his outstanding performance in the anime business. Takahashi’s personal net worth is believed to be approximately $6 million.
7. Hirohiko Araki
Net Worth: $13 Million

Hirohiko Araki is a well-known manga artist in Japan, best known for his hit series JoJo’s Bizarre Adventure. Hirohiko’s manga has sold over 100 million copies to date, making it one of the best manga of all time.
The JoJo’s Bizarre Adventure franchise consists of nine manga sequels, one-shots, light novels, and video games, bringing Hirohiko’s net worth to roughly $13-15 million.
Since 2005, numerous live-action films and anime adaptations have been created, and the trend is far from ended. Fans adore this show, and it is expected to soar to new heights in the coming years.
6. Masashi Kishimoto
Net Worth: $25 Million

Masashi Kishimoto is a well-known face among anime lovers and one of Japan’s top mangaka and most influential persons. He is the creator of the popular anime series Naruto.
Naruto is the world’s fourth best-selling manga series, with over 250 million copies sold in nearly 47 countries. It has won multiple honours and has appeared on the bestseller lists of both US Today and The New York Times.
Kishimoto’s exact net worth is unknown, although according to sources, he is worth between $25 and $27 million. He is currently working on the Naruto sequel “Boruto: Naruto Next Generations,” which is also proving to be a successful series.
5. Yoshihiro Togashi
Net Worth: $30 Million

Yoshihiro Togashi is widely known for his renowned manga series Hunter X Hunter and Yu Yu Hakusho. Both of these manga are extremely popular and have been converted into successful anime.
On the one hand, Hunter X Hunter has 80 million copies in circulation, but Yu Yu Hakusho has sold over 50 million copies in Japan alone. These two were critical successes in the 1990s, and they were well accepted by fans.
Togashi worked on several other mangas in his early days, but these two made him the richest manga writer of all time. Togashi’s net worth is expected to be approximately $30 million in 2022.
4. Hajime Isayama
Net Worth: $45 Million

When Hajime Isayama began working on Attack On Titan in 2005, he had no idea that his creation would lead him to the position of richest manga writer in 2021.
Despite being rejected by Weekly Shonen Jump, Isayama persisted with his storyboard and took Attack On Titan to Kodansha. It is now one of the most popular anime series among fans.
Isayama garnered multiple prizes for his outstanding work, including the Kodansha Manga Award and the Harvey Award. Attack On Titan has sold over 100 million copies to date, with sales continuing to rise.
Isayama’s net worth is reported to be between $45 and $46 million, including royalties from manga sales and anime production.
3. Gosho Aoyama
Net Worth: $50 Million

Gosho Aoyama is the creator of the mystery and crime-solving manga series Detective Conan. Detective Conan, also known as Case Closed, is a manga about a boy who deals with difficult cases while also going to school.
Case Closed is one of the most popular manga series, with over 1000 anime episodes and 240 million copies sold. Aoyama’s net worth is close to $50 million, with manga sales accounting for a large portion of it.
Aoyama began drawing at a young age and, in addition to Case Closed, has drawn other manga since the late 1980s. His other manga series include Magic Kito and Yaiba.
2. Akira Toriyama
Net Worth: $55 Million

Akira Toriyama is often regarded as the manga industry’s Godfather, and this is entirely accurate. Anime and manga gained recognition in the West as a result of his extra efforts in the Japanese business. People learn about anime through the legendary manga Dragon Ball.
People learned about anime for the first time because to Dragon Ball. In the 1990s, it was the most popular series. His manga sales from various Dragon Ball sequels are estimated to be around 300 million, with a sizable part sold in the West.
Akira Toriyama’s net worth is believed to be $55-57 million, and this is due to more than simply the Dragon Ball franchise. He is also in charge of character design in the Dragon Ball Quest video game series. He has also created several more mangas, including his first hit comedic series Dr. Slump.
1. Eiichiro Oda
Net Worth: $230 Million

No one in the history of the anime and manga industries has ever risen to the top of the richest manga writers of all time like Eiichiro Oda. He is the richest mangaka, with a net worth of more than $230 million.
His most famous Creation, One Piece, is one of the best shōnen anime series viewers have ever seen, and it has been amusing fans for the past 22 years. In terms of manga sales, One Piece has sold over 490 million copies, placing it second only to Superman in terms of sales.
He became a manga artist at the age of 17 and created such a fantastic story as One Piece that transformed the history of the manga business. It is nearly hard for anyone else to come close to Oda’s accomplishments over the last 20 years.
